How Removing White Sugar Helps Hormones and Joints

White sugar spikes insulin and cortisol, which worsen perimenopausal and menopausal hormonal changes. By staying white sugar-free for these weeks, you've likely lowered inflammation that fuels joint pain and made daily movement more realistic without the gym schedules you don't have time for. Many of my clients see their fasting blood glucose drop 10-20 points within the first month, easing both diabetes management and blood pressure. This isn't another restrictive diet—it's a sustainable swap that fits middle-income realities and doesn't require insurance-covered programs.

Practical Wins You're Probably Already Feeling

Without white sugar, cravings usually calm after 10-14 days, energy stabilizes, and emotional eating decreases. If joint pain has made exercise feel impossible, notice how much easier short walks or gentle stretching become when inflammation is lower. In the CFP Method, we pair this with simple plate-building: half non-starchy vegetables, quarter lean protein, quarter complex carbs like quinoa or sweet potato. No complex meal plans needed—just consistent, repeatable choices that address the overwhelm of conflicting nutrition advice.
